gamecheck icon gamecheck

A simple Android application to search videogames and its games. It aims to test new frameworks version and show some skills. I 'm going to use Dagger, Mockito for mock unit tests, JUnit for tradicional unit tests, Retrofit, Gson, Picasso, ButterKnife and Android Design Support Library. I’ve developed this project using MVP architecture and I’ve “programmed to an interface” to be able to do inversion of control. My view layer is the more passive as possible and in this way I can focus my unit tests on presenter and model layers. I like to strongly separate each layer and charge the presenter to call the other layers.

spotifystreamer icon spotifystreamer

A part of the Android Developer Nanodegree program. Built an app, optimized for tablet, that displays an artist's top 10 tracks on Spotify. The user interface allows for search capability, displays a list of the top 10 tracks in a scrolling list complete with album art, and provides streaming playback of audio using Android's mediaplayer API.
